AI大模型作为当今人工智能领域的明星技术,其背后的训练过程涉及多个专业领域的知识和技术。以下将详细介绍AI大模型训练背后的神秘力量,以及相关的专业知识。
一、深度学习
1.1 定义
深度学习是机器学习的一个子领域,它使用类似于大脑的神经网络结构来学习数据中的复杂模式。
1.2 基本原理
深度学习模型通过多层神经网络对数据进行特征提取和分类,其中每一层都对输入数据进行变换,最终输出预测结果。
1.3 关键技术
- 神经网络架构:包括卷积神经网络(CNN)、循环神经网络(RNN)和Transformer等。
- 激活函数:如ReLU、Sigmoid、Tanh等,用于引入非线性因素。
- 损失函数:如均方误差(MSE)、交叉熵损失等,用于衡量预测结果与真实值之间的差异。
二、自然语言处理(NLP)
2.1 定义
自然语言处理是人工智能的一个分支,旨在使计算机能够理解、解释和生成人类语言。
2.2 基本原理
NLP通过文本分析、语义理解、语音识别等技术,使计算机能够处理和理解自然语言。
2.3 关键技术
- 词嵌入:将单词转换为向量表示,以便在神经网络中进行处理。
- 序列到序列模型:如编码器-解码器架构,用于机器翻译、文本摘要等任务。
- 预训练语言模型:如BERT、GPT等,通过在大量文本数据上进行预训练,学习语言模式和知识。
三、计算机视觉(CV)
3.1 定义
计算机视觉是人工智能的一个分支,旨在使计算机能够从图像或视频中提取信息。
3.2 基本原理
CV通过图像处理、特征提取、目标检测等技术,使计算机能够识别和理解图像中的内容。
3.3 关键技术
- 卷积神经网络(CNN):用于图像分类、目标检测等任务。
- 目标检测算法:如R-CNN、Faster R-CNN、YOLO等。
- 图像分割:将图像划分为不同的区域,用于语义分割等任务。
四、数据科学
4.1 定义
数据科学是统计学、信息科学、计算机科学等多个领域的交叉学科,旨在从大量数据中提取有价值的信息。
4.2 基本原理
数据科学通过数据清洗、数据可视化、统计分析等技术,从数据中提取洞察力。
4.3 关键技术
- 数据预处理:包括数据清洗、数据集成、数据转换等。
- 数据可视化:通过图表、图形等方式展示数据分布和关系。
- 统计分析:如假设检验、回归分析等,用于分析数据中的规律。
五、硬件与软件
5.1 硬件
AI大模型的训练需要大量的计算资源,包括GPU、TPU等硬件加速器。
5.2 软件
- 深度学习框架:如TensorFlow、PyTorch、Keras等,用于构建和训练深度学习模型。
- 分布式训练框架:如Horovod、Ray等,用于在多台机器上并行训练模型。
六、总结
AI大模型训练背后的神秘力量涉及多个专业领域的知识和技术。了解这些专业,有助于我们更好地理解和应用AI大模型技术。随着AI技术的不断发展,这些专业知识将更加重要,为人工智能领域带来更多的机遇和挑战。